Volunteer at Kano: Data Collection Officer at Widow’s Mite Reach Out Foundation (WIMROF)

The Widow’s Mite Reach Out Foundation (WIMROF) is focused on developing sustainable solutions in health, education, and livelihoods, specifically to uplift and empower communities. Their efforts prioritize aiding vulnerable groups, underserved populations, and individuals with disabilities.

Volunteer Opportunity Overview

  • Location: Kano, Nigeria
  • Role: Full-time on-site volunteer for WIMROF

Role Responsibilities

Volunteers will directly engage with communities to support initiatives in health, education, and livelihood improvement. Tasks may involve organizing activities, providing assistance to beneficiaries, and collaborating with team members to achieve WIMROF’s goals.

Key Qualifications

  • Strong communication and interpersonal abilities
  • Capacity to work effectively in team settings
  • Compassion and sensitivity towards vulnerable populations
  • Proficiency in local languages spoken in Kano
  • Adaptability to dynamic situations
  • Educational background: BSc, HND, NCE, or equivalent qualifications in relevant fields such as developmental studies
  • Computer skills are advantageous
